Ingredients
For this Extra Cheesy Garlic Bread, you’ll need:
For the Bread
- 1 large French baguette or Italian loaf
For the Garlic Butter Mixture
- 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1 teaspoon dried parsley
- ½ teaspoon salt
- ¼ teaspoon ground black pepper
For the Cheese Topping
- 1 cup mozzarella cheese, shredded
- ½ cup cheddar cheese, shredded
- 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
For Garnish
-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)

How to Make Extra Cheesy Garlic Bread
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). This ensures that your bread bakes evenly.
Step 2: Prepare the Garlic Butter
In a medium bowl:
1. Mix the softened butter with minced garlic.
2. Add oregano, parsley, salt, and black pepper.
3. Stir until well combined.
Step 3: Slice the Bread
Cut the baguette in half lengthwise. Place both halves on a baking sheet with the cut side facing up.
Step 4: Spread the Mixture
Evenly spread the garlic butter mixture over each half of the bread using a spatula.
Step 5: Add the Cheese
Top each half with mozzarella, cheddar, and Parmesan cheese. Ensure even distribution so every bite is cheesy!
Step 6: Bake the Bread
Place the baking sheet in your preheated oven. Bake for 12-15 minutes or until melted and bubbly with golden brown edges.
Step 7: Garnish and Serve
Remove from oven and sprinkle freshly chopped parsley on top. Slice into pieces and serve warm. Enjoy your Extra Cheesy Garlic Bread!

How to Perfect Extra Cheesy Garlic Bread
To ensure that your Extra Cheesy Garlic Bread is nothing short of perfection, keep these helpful tips in mind.
- Choose Fresh Bread: Opt for a fresh French baguette or Italian loaf for the best texture and flavor.
- Use Quality Cheese: Invest in high-quality mozzarella, cheddar, and Parmesan cheese for maximum flavor and gooeyness.
- Customize the Herbs: Feel free to experiment with different herbs like basil or thyme to suit your taste preferences.
- Avoid Overbaking: Keep an eye on the bread while it’s baking; you want melted cheese without burning the edges.
- Let It Rest: Allow the bread to cool slightly before slicing; this helps maintain its cheesy integrity.
- Reheat Properly: If you have leftovers, reheat them in the oven instead of the microwave to preserve crispiness.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Making Extra Cheesy Garlic Bread is simple, but some common mistakes can hinder the final result. Here are a few pitfalls to watch out for:
- Using Cold Butter: Starting with cold butter makes it hard to mix with the garlic and herbs. Always use softened butter for an even spread.
- Overloading on Garlic: While garlic adds flavor, too much can overpower the dish. Stick to the recommended amount for a balanced taste.
- Skipping Fresh Herbs: Dried herbs are convenient, but fresh herbs elevate the flavor. Whenever possible, use fresh parsley and oregano for the best results.
- Not Toasting Long Enough: If you don’t bake it long enough, your bread may be soggy instead of crispy. Aim for golden brown edges for that perfect crunch.
- Ignoring Cheese Quality: The type of cheese can make a difference in flavor. Opt for high-quality cheeses like fresh mozzarella and aged Parmesan for maximum cheesiness.
Refrigerator Storage
- Store Extra Cheesy Garlic Bread in an airtight container.
- It will stay fresh in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
Freezing Extra Cheesy Garlic Bread
- Wrap each piece tightly in plastic wrap or foil before freezing.
- It can be frozen for up to 3 months without losing flavor.
Reheating Extra Cheesy Garlic Bread
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and reheat for about 10 minutes until warm and cheesy.
- Microwave: Heat on medium power for 30 seconds, but this may result in softer bread.
- Stovetop: Heat on a skillet over medium heat for about 5 minutes, flipping occasionally for even warmth.
